- What does the 11.1 million barrel decrease in U.S. crude oil inventories signify?
- This substantial decrease indicates that more crude oil was consumed or exported than produced and imported during the week ending January 30. It suggests a tightening of the domestic supply-demand balance, often leading to upward pressure on crude oil prices.
- Why did U.S. crude oil inventories drop so sharply this particular week?
- The significant drop is primarily attributed to the aftermath of severe storms across the United States. Such weather events can disrupt crude oil production, transportation, and refining operations, leading to temporary imbalances that result in large inventory draws as demand outstrips available supply.
- What is the Strategic Petroleum Reserve (SPR) and why is its status mentioned?
- The SPR is the U.S. government's emergency crude oil stockpile, designed to mitigate major supply disruptions. Its continued replenishment, as noted in the report, signifies ongoing efforts to rebuild national energy security reserves after significant releases in 2022, providing a strategic buffer for future market stability.